An associate in Dickinson Wright’s Phoenix office, Caroline Hilgert focuses on civil litigation. During law school, she gained valuable experience as a teaching fellow for Civil Procedure, as well as participating in the Community Immigration Law Placement Clinic, the Gender Justice Clinic, and the Barry Davis mock trial team, gaining courtroom experience and sharpening her litigation skills. While at the at the University of Arizona, James E. Rogers College of Law, she was awarded CALI Excellence for the Future Awards in Civil Procedure and Advanced Trial Advocacy. She also held the role of Articles Editor for the Arizona Journal of International and Comparative Law.
